TIP power amplifier output.
Battery Ground - To be connected to zero potential. All loop current and longitudinal current flow from this ground.
Internally separate from AGND but it is recommended that it is connected to the same potential as AGND.
Low battery supply connection.
High battery supply connection for the most negative battery.
Uncommitted switch positive terminal.
Uncommitted switch negative terminal.
Switch control input. This TTL compatible input controls the uncommitted switch, with a logic “0” enabling the switch
and logic “1” disabling the switch.
Mode Control Input - MSB. F2-F0 for the TTL compatible parallel control interface for controlling the various modes of
operation of the device.
Mode control input.
Mode control input.
Detector Output Selection Input. This TTL input controls the multiplexing of the SHD (E0 = 1) and GKD (E0 = 0) comparator
outputs to the DET output based upon the state at the F2-F0 pins (see the Device Operating Modes table shown on page 2).
Detector Output - This TTL output provides on-hook/off-hook status of the loop based upon the selected operating
mode. The detected output will either be switch hook, ground key or ring trip (see the Device Operating Modes table
shown on page 2).
Thermal Shutdown Alarm. This pin signals the internal die temperature has exceeded safe operating temperature
(approximately 175°C) and the device has been powered down automatically.
Analog ground reference. This pin should be externally connected to BGND.
Selects between high and low battery, with a logic “1” selecting the high battery and logic “0” the low battery.
Programming pin for the transient current limit feature, set by an external resistor to ground.
External capacitor on this pin sets the polarity reversal time.
Ringing Signal Input - Analog input for driving 2-wire interface while in Ring Mode.
Analog Receive Voltage - 4-wire analog audio input voltage. AC couples to CODEC.
Transmit Output Voltage - Output of impedance matching amplifier, AC couples to CODEC.
Feedback voltage for impedance matching. This voltage is scaled to accomplish impedance matching.
Impedance matching amplifier summing node.
Positive voltage power supply, usually +5V.
DC Biasing Filter Capacitor - Connects between this pin and V
Ring trip filter network.
Loop Current Limit programming resistor.
Switch hook detection threshold programming resistor.
RING power amplifier output.
